摘要
进行了垃圾焚烧飞灰的新型稳定化药剂——重金属螯合剂的实验室研究,探讨了本螯合剂处理焚烧飞灰的稳定化工艺流程及处理效果.结果表明,本螯合剂对飞灰中重金属的总捕集效率高达97%以上,其效果显著优于无机稳定化药剂Na2S和石灰,且处理后的飞灰能达到重金属废物的填埋控制标准,同时,其处理后的飞灰的最大浸出量远低于无机稳定化药剂处理后的飞灰,且能在较宽的pH范围内都具有好的稳定化效果。
The synthesizing method of heavy metal chelating agent was explored in this paper.The technology process and treatment efficiency of the chelating agent in treating with fly ash were experimentally studied.The results indicated that the efficiency of heavy metal chelating agent in treating with fly ash was higher than that of using Na2S and lime,futhermore,the treated fly ash using this chelating agent can reach the landfilling standards for heavy metal waste.The maximum leaching quantity of heavy metal for the treated fly ash using this chelating agent was much lower than that for the treated fly ash using Na2S and lime,and it can keep stabilization within a broader pH value.Thus the risk of secondary pollution for the treated waste was reduced dramatically when the environment condition changes.
